Description

Ice breaking device for fishing in winter
The technical field is as follows:
the invention relates to the technical field of fishing equipment, in particular to an ice breaking device for fishing in winter.
Background art:
people usually need to break the ice layer on the water surface in the extremely low temperature region for fishing, fish in the water is caught by using a fishing net or fishing after the ice layer is broken, ice breaking and fishing are carried out once every year in the dry lake region in China, the ice layer is broken very difficultly for the ice breaking and fishing, a plurality of people are usually needed to break the ice layer by using an ice shovel, the mode of breaking the ice layer wastes manpower, part of mechanical ice breaking is carried out at present, but the mechanical ice breaking is usually carried out by using the lifting of an electric push rod, and the ice breaking is failed and wastes time due to the fact that the ice surface is slippery, and the machine is easy to displace in the mechanical ice breaking process, so that the ice breaking is failed.

as shown in fig. 1 to 4, the following technical solutions are adopted in the present embodiment: an ice breaking device for fishing in winter comprises two U-shaped frames 1, two lifting mechanisms 2, two supporting mechanisms 3, a rotating mechanism 4, an ice breaking mechanism 5, a cross rod 6, a connecting rod 7 and a power box 34, wherein the two U-shaped frames 1 are arranged in parallel, the top end and the bottom end of each U-shaped frame 1 are respectively and symmetrically and fixedly connected with the cross rod 6 and the connecting rod 7, the lifting mechanisms 2 are arranged at the middle positions of the U-shaped frames 1, the power box 34 is arranged between the two lifting mechanisms 2, the supporting mechanisms 3 are arranged at the bottom end of each lifting mechanism 2, the rotating mechanism 4 is arranged inside each power box 34, the ice breaking mechanism 5 is arranged at the bottom of each power box 34, each lifting mechanism 2 consists of an installation box 8, a lead screw 9, a sliding block 10 and a first motor 11, the installation boxes 8 are two, and the two installation boxes 8 are respectively and fixedly connected at the middle positions of the bottoms of the two U-shaped frames 1, the inside of install bin 8 is equipped with lead screw 9, the bottom of connecting at the 8 inner walls of install bin is rotated to the bottom of lead screw 9, the top fixed mounting of install bin 8 has first motor 11, the top fixed connection of install bin 8 and lead screw 9 is passed to the output shaft tip of first motor 11, the outside of lead screw 9 is equipped with slider 10, the top of slider 10 is equipped with vertical direction screw hole, lead screw 9 passes through threaded connection with slider 10, the side of install bin 8 is equipped with the recess of vertical direction, the tip cooperation sliding connection of slider 10 is in the recess, slider 10 is located the outside one end fixed connection of install bin 8 and has headstock 34.
Wherein, rotary mechanism 4 includes battery 12, second motor 13, transfer line 15, worm wheel 16, worm 17, fixed plate 18 and carousel 19, battery 12 fixed mounting is in the inside one end of headstock 34, the inside of headstock 34 is equipped with transfer line 15, the top of transfer line 15 rotates the top of connecting at headstock 34 inner wall, headstock 34 is passed to the bottom of transfer line 15, the inside one side fixedly connected with fixed plate 18 that is located transfer line 15 of headstock 34, the inside outside fixedly connected with worm wheel 16 that is located transfer line 15 of headstock 34, the outside of worm wheel 16 is equipped with worm 17, worm wheel 16 is connected with worm 17 meshing, the one end of worm 17 rotates the side of connecting at fixed plate 18, the one end fixed mounting who keeps away from battery 12 in headstock 34 has second motor 13, the output shaft of second motor 13 passes through speed reducer 14 and is connected with the other end of worm 17, the end of the transmission rod 15, which is positioned outside the power box 34, is fixedly connected with a rotating disc 19.
Wherein, the ice breaking mechanism 5 comprises a sleeve 20, a telescopic spring 21, a slide bar 22, a driving box 23, a third motor 24, a half gear 25, a rack 26 and an ice breaking cone 27, the sleeve 20 is fixedly connected with the outer side of the rotating disc 19, the top of the inner wall of the sleeve 20 is fixedly connected with a telescopic spring 21, the end of the extension spring 21 is fixedly connected with a slide bar 22, the inner wall of the sleeve 20 is provided with a slide rail, the sliding rod 22 is slidably connected inside the sleeve 20, a rack 26 is fixedly connected to the side edge of the sliding rod 22, the center of the bottom of the sliding rod 22 is fixedly connected with an ice breaking cone 27, the side edge of the sleeve 20 is fixedly connected with a driving box 23, the driving box 23 is communicated with the interior of the sleeve 20, a third motor 24 is fixedly arranged in the driving box 23, the end part of the output shaft of the third motor 24 is fixedly connected with a half gear 25, and the half gear 25 is meshed with a rack 26.
Wherein, supporting mechanism 3 includes electric telescopic handle 28, slide 29, connecting plate 30 and fourth motor 31, the bottom fixedly connected with electric telescopic handle 28 of install bin 8 side, the inside below sliding connection who is located lead screw 9 of install bin 8 has slide 29, the side of install bin 8 is equipped with the spout of vertical direction, the tip cooperation sliding connection of slide 29 is in the spout, slide 29 is located the outside one end fixedly connected with connecting plate 30 of install bin 8, electric telescopic handle 28's piston rod tip fixed connection is at the top of connecting plate 30, the top fixed mounting of connecting plate 30 has fourth motor 31, the output shaft tip of fourth motor 31 passes connecting plate 30 fixedly connected with fixed drill bit 32.
Wherein, the side of the U-shaped frame 1 is fixedly connected with a handle 33, which is convenient for moving.
Two corresponding side walls of the sliding block 10 are in contact with two corresponding inner walls of the installation box 8, so that the installation box 8 can move up and down conveniently.
The width of the sliding rod 22 at one end inside the sleeve 20 is greater than the width of the sliding rod 22 at one end outside the sleeve 20, so that the ice-chiseling face is convenient.
A speed reducer 14 is fixedly connected to the outer side of the output shaft of the second motor 13, so that the rotating speed of the second motor 13 can be reduced conveniently.
The using state of the invention is as follows: the two U-shaped frames 1 are symmetrically and fixedly arranged, the two U-shaped frames 1 can form four supporting legs, the device can be supported, the third motor 24 is controlled to work, the half gear 25 is rotated, the sliding rod 22 moves upwards when the half gear 25 rotates due to the meshing connection of the half gear 25 and the rack 26, the expansion spring 21 is compressed, when the half gear 25 is not meshed with the rack 26, the sliding rod 22 is pushed down under the action of the expansion spring 21 at the moment, the up-and-down reciprocating motion of the ice breaking cone 27 is realized, the ice breaking of the ice breaking cone 27 is facilitated, the second motor 13 is controlled to work, the worm 17 is rotated, the worm 17 is meshed with the worm wheel 16 to rotate the worm wheel 16, the rotation of the transmission rod 15 is realized, the rotating motion of the ice breaking cone 27 is realized, the ice can be broken on a set area, the screw rod 9 is rotated by the work of the first motor 11, and the screw rod 9 is connected with the slide block 10 through threads, the sliding block 10 can move up and down outside the screw rod 9, so that the ice breaking cone 27 is driven to move up and down, the sliding plate 29 can be controlled to move up and down in the mounting box 8 through the extension and contraction of the electric telescopic rod 28, the fourth motor 31 is controlled to work, the electric telescopic rod 28 extends, the fixed drill bit 32 rotates while moving down, and the device can be fixed in an enhanced mode.
